How they compare

Syrian Arab Republic currently reports 0.84 deaths per 100,000 people against 0.82 deaths per 100,000 people in Zimbabwe, a difference of 0.02 deaths per 100,000 people.

Across all 22 years both countries report, Syrian Arab Republic has been ahead every year.

Syrian Arab Republic ranks 150th and Zimbabwe ranks 153rd of 194 countries.

Syrian Arab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Syrian Arab Republic Zimbabwe Difference Ahead
2000s 0.77 deaths per 100,000 people 0.51 deaths per 100,000 people 0.26 deaths per 100,000 people Syrian Arab Republic
2010s 0.817 deaths per 100,000 people 0.645 deaths per 100,000 people 0.172 deaths per 100,000 people Syrian Arab Republic
2020s 0.83 deaths per 100,000 people 0.785 deaths per 100,000 people 0.045 deaths per 100,000 people Syrian Arab Republic

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
